Anthony Tjan

Vice Chairman

Mr. Tjan joined Parthenon in 2001 and serves as our firm's Vice Chairman and also previously served for five years as a Senior Partner. He is CEO and Managing Partner of The Cue Ball Group, a private investment firm focused on information media and consumer businesses. In 1996, he founded the pioneering web development and services company, ZEFER (now Niteo Partners of NEC), where he was a driving force behind the company's vision and growth to more than 800 people. Mr. Tjan holds an A.B. in Biology from Harvard College, an M.B.A. from Harvard Business School and was a Belfer Center Fellow at Harvard's Kennedy School of Government.

Mr. Tjan is also a recognized thought leader in the business arena and is a World Economic Forum Global Leader of Tomorrow. He has a regular blog featured on Harvard Business Online, “>Upstarts and Titans.” He is also a frequent contributing author to several publications including the Harvard Business Review, where he co-authored one of their most popular customer strategy articles, "Transforming Strategy One Customer at a Time.”
